Abstract
A Raman scattering image of a single-wall carbon nanotube (SWCNT) is further analyzed using SIMPLISM and moving-window two-dimensional auto-correlation spectroscopy (MW2DACS). The G band from the SWCNT (obtained from SIMPLISMA) is composed of Breit–Wigner–Fano and Lorentzian peak profiles. The SWCNT is identified as metallic from the broad Breit–Wigner–Fano peak shape. MW2DACS is successfully applied to the image with an enhancement in spatial resolution from 350 nm (image filtering using SWCNT G band) to 200 nm.
